The Kurlana Tapa Youth Justice Centre is South Australia’s main secure environment for young people in custody, that's managed by the Department of Human Services. Kurlana Tapa is committed to providing a safe environment that supports young people to develop positive behaviours and take responsibility for the choices and the progress they make, set goals, develop life skills and address dysfunctional patterns of behaviour.

Approach
At S4G, we follow a value-driven enterprise architecture philosophy where every technical decision is anchored to our clients' business goals.
We knew that technology alone wouldn't resolve the organisation's challenges, and so our first priority was spending time at Kurlana Tapa to understand the lived experience of staff in a highly secure, demanding, and unique working environment.
We then focused on the organisation's vision, identifying several strategic objectives with its leaders that would set a framework for our technology blueprint, roadmap, and business case.
Once we'd established this robust business understanding and framework, we facilitated targeted and deeply collaborative workshops to understand and document Kurlana Tapa's existing technology ecosystem and pain points.
Then our focus moved towards the future: building a robust technology blueprint anchored to meaningful business objectives, supported by a modular roadmap of initiatives and a convincing investment Business Case.

Solution & Future Vision
The blueprint outlines a future state vision built on a modernized technology stack, integrated systems, and a cloud-first approach. Recommended solutions include:
Core System Replacement
Migrating from DORIS to a modern, integrated case management system will enable staff to manage all day-to-day activities from a single, unified workspace. This new system will enable streamlined, end-to-end case management, improving operational efficiency and reducing manual effort.
Secure Cloud Platform
Transitioning to a secure, scalable cloud environment provides the flexibility and resilience needed to support future growth and innovation. This ensures business continuity and provides a foundation for rapid deployment of new services.
Data Integration Platform
Establishing seamless data exchange between all systems breaks down information silos and creates a single source of truth. This empowers staff with a holistic view of information, facilitating more informed and timely decision-making.
Enhanced Security Framework
Implementing robust security measures across all layers provides a 'security by design' approach, protecting sensitive information and ensuring the department meets its compliance obligations. This builds confidence in the technology ecosystem and safeguards critical data.
Advanced Analytics
Deploying tools for robust reporting and data-driven decision-making will transform raw data into actionable insights. This enables leaders to monitor key performance indicators in real-time and make strategic decisions based on evidence, not just intuition.
Improved User Experience
Architecting a new staff portal providing intuitive, role-based access to tools and information, simplifying tasks and improving productivity.
